Which entrance exams does DY Patil College of Architecture accept for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.)?
0 Follower
A
Atul MishraCurrent Student
Beginner-Level 1
The DY Patil College of Architecture accepts NATA (National Aptitude Test in Architecture) Exam or JEE Paper II for admission to the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) program.

Do private companies hire from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) at DY Patil College of Architecture?
0 Follower
A
Atul MishraCurrent Student
Beginner-Level 1
Yes, private companies hire from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) at DY Patil College of Architecture. Some of the companies that have hired students from this programme include Adani Realty, S.P. Design Studio, Accurate and Associates Pvt.

How to get admission to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) at DY Patil College of Architecture?
0 Follower
A
Atul MishraCurrent Student
Beginner-Level 1
To get admission to the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) at D Y Patil College of Architecture, candidates must meet the eligibility criteria, which includes passing 10+2 or an equivalent examination with Physics and Mathematics as compulsory
...more
To get admission to the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) at D Y Patil College of Architecture, candidates must meet the eligibility criteria, which includes passing 10+2 or an equivalent examination with Physics and Mathematics as compulsory subjects along with either Chemistry or Biology or Technical Vocational subject or Computer Science/IT/Informatics Practices/Engineering Graphics/Business Studies with a minimum of 45% marks in aggregate. Alternatively, candidates who have passed the 10+3 Diploma Examination with Mathematics as a compulsory subject with at least 45% marks in aggregate are also eligible. Additionally, candidates need to qualify an aptitude test in architecture, such as NATA (National Aptitude Test in Architecture) or JEE Paper II. The annual fee for the course is ₹1,50,000, and the application fee is ₹1,000. The admission process and timelines can be found on the college's website.

Which college offers maximum number of BA specialisations among Fergusson College and Dr. DY Patil ACS College?
0 Follower
4 Views
K
Kartik SharmaCurrent Student
Contributor-Level 10
Dr. D. Y. Patil ACS College offers six specialsiations in the BA course, namely, English, Geography, Psychology, Sociology, Political Science, and Economics. Moreover, Fergusson College offers more than 15 specialisations in the BA course. The
...more
Dr. D. Y. Patil ACS College offers six specialsiations in the BA course, namely, English, Geography, Psychology, Sociology, Political Science, and Economics. Moreover, Fergusson College offers more than 15 specialisations in the BA course. The names of some of the offered BA specialsiations at Fergusson College are, Economics, Music, Statistics, Mathematics, Sanskrit, Marathi, German, French, etc. Therefore, Fergusson College offers a broader range of BA specialisations compared to Dr. D.Y. Patil ACS College, providing students with more options to align their studies with their interests and career goals.

Is it worth paying for the Bachelor of Architecture (B.Arch.) at DY Patil College of Architecture?
0 Follower
A
Atul MishraCurrent Student
Beginner-Level 1
Whether D.Y. Patil College of Architecture is worth it for you depends on your career goals, financial situation, and personal preferences. It may be a good choice if you are looking for a solid education in architecture with good support for
...more
Whether D.Y. Patil College of Architecture is worth it for you depends on your career goals, financial situation, and personal preferences. It may be a good choice if you are looking for a solid education in architecture with good support for placements and extracurricular activities.
Pros:
1. Accreditation: The college is recognised by the Council of Architecture (CoA) and offers a structured BArch programme that meets national standards.
2. Infrastructure: The college typically boasts good infrastructure, including well-equipped studios, libraries, and workshops that are essential for architectural studies.
3. Faculty: The faculty often includes experienced professionals and academicians who can provide valuable insights and mentorship.
4. Placement Opportunities: The college usually has a decent placement record, with connections to various architectural firms and industries, which can be beneficial for internships and job placements.
5. Extracurricular Activities: D.Y. Patil College encourages participation in workshops, seminars, and design competitions, which can enhance practical skills and networking opportunities.
Cons:
1. Location: While Mumbai is a hub for architecture and design, the cost of living can be high, and competition for internships and jobs is intense.
2. Reputation: While the college is well-regarded, it may not have the same national recognition as some of the top architecture schools in India, like the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) or the National Institute of Design (NID).
3. Curriculum: Some students may feel that the curriculum could be more innovative or aligned with current architectural trends, so it's worth researching the specific courses offered.
